This is a review for the music. If you're into MoFi vinyl this is the place to go for deals. They have a section of returns for whatever reasons (usually seam splits) that go for great values. It has a low profile store front that doesn't offer any clues as to what's inside but trust me there are some bargains to be had here. And the guy who overlooks the vinyl, Rob, is well educated in music and you can listen before buying on open items.
